PHOENIX - A lawyer wounded in this week's Phoenix office shooting has died.
 
Mark Hummels had been on life support at a Phoenix hospital after Wednesday morning's shooting that killed a Scottsdale-based company's CEO.
 
His law firm's publicist, Athia Hardt, says Hummels died Thursday night.
 
Police say the gunman -- 70-year-old Arthur Douglas Harmon -- was found dead early Thursday in Mesa from an apparent self-inflicted gunshot wound.
 
They say Harmon opened fire at the end of a mediation session over a lawsuit he filed last April.
 
A woman also was shot, but her injuries were not life-threatening.
 
The 43-year-old Hummels worked with the law firm Osborn Maledon and focused on business disputes, real estate litigation and malpractice defense.
